About the role
The Line Maintenance Mechanic I performs responsible unskilled and semi-skilled work in the installation, replacement, repair, and maintenance of the Town’s water and sewer lines and related appurtenances. This position works as part of a crew engaged in utility construction and maintenance activities that are essential to delivering safe and reliable water and wastewater services to the community.
Duties and responsibilities
- Operate tapping machines to make water and sewer taps and service connections in accordance with standards
- Lay, repair, and replace water and sewer pipes and related facilities
- Install, service, and test water meters and meter setters
- Operate sewer rodders to clear blockages
- Operate front-end loaders, dump trucks, jackhammers, tampers, trenchers, air compressors, boring machines, and other construction equipment
- Install hydrants, valves, clamps, meters, and related pipeline apparatus
- Set meter boxes and repair or replace fire hydrants
- Operate tractors with bush hog attachments to maintain water and sewer easements and rights-of-way
- Assist with backfilling and compacting excavation sites
- Perform other related duties as required
